Rio de Janeiro, Brazil
GPSC Mayors Round Table and Urban Nature Forum
-
In the lead-up to COP30, a series of high-level gatherings will take place in Rio de Janeiro from November 3–6, 2025, bringing together mayors and local leaders from around the world. These events will spotlight bold city leadership on climate action, highlight subnational priorities, and mobilize resources for an ambitious and inclusive COP30 agenda. Online
Showcasing how Earth Observation data can help inform nature-relevant decision-making in cities
28 January - 28 January 2026, 8:30 CET
The European Space Agency (ESA), in collaboration with the Urban Nature Program, will host this webinar to showcase how Earth Observation (EO) data can support nature-relevant decision-making in cities, with a particular focus on climate adaptation and urban nature outcomes.
